10 Causes of Blocked Drains and How to Prevent Them

Homeowners can face different problems in their homes, like damaged walls and flooring or insufficient money for bills. But aside from these, clogged drains can also be an issue. Blocked drains Newcastle can be an inconvenience and may lead to more problems if kept unrepaired. 


Here are some of the many causes of blocked drains and how to prevent them:


Food Waste


When you clean your plates and utensils, there are food residues that may not get removed easily. And with that, you need extra effort to wash them. However, never remove them from the sink and scrape your plates into the trash instead. Some homeowners put sink strainers to catch the ones that were not removed from the trash, like rice and eggshells. Knowing what items could harm your drain will help you be more mindful when washing.


Hair and Soap Residue


People with hair fall problems might stress over the hair that keeps going down the drain. With this, ensure you have a strainer to catch hair and avoid clogged drains. But aside from hair, soap can also be a problem. If you use a bar, you will notice it gets smaller after weeks or months of usage. But instead of letting them go to the drain, you can get a new one and stick the small and old soap.

Foreign Objects


Throwing sanitary napkins, dental floss, wet wipes, and cotton balls in your sink or toilet bowl can damage the drainage and result in clogging. You better throw them in the trash to avoid damaging anything in your home. You will see different disposal options, so choose one that is appropriate for the item.

Grease and Cooking Oil


Grease and cooking oil can cause issues with your drains, even if they are liquid. It can start some greasy buildup, damaging and blocking drains. So instead of throwing them into the sink or toilet, let them solidify, then put them in a container before disposing. There are other ways to dispose of your cooking oil, so check what fits your needs.
